The authors present VLA and WSRT data on 5 extended radio sources identified with first ranked galaxies in rich Abell clusters. The observing frequency is 1.4 GHz for A98, A160, A278, A568 and 4.9 GHz for A115, A160, A568. These sources show a variety of morphologies, ranging from head-tail type to extremely collimated jets. The trend of spectral index and polarization data are given, when possible. It seems likely that these sources are interacting with the ambient gas, which is revealed by X-ray observations.
